ALSO if you've never heard of bounce rubberizer by hotwirefoam factory go buy some on amazon. mix that with cornstarch until you get a thick paste and trowel that onto your eva. smooth with water and brush or sponge. you get a hard flexible coating that is sandable. mix well spread evenly. it does shrink but doesn't crack. what looks like an 1/8th thick layer will shrink down to like a 1/16". for more rubbery effects spray or brush on straight. dilute as little with water as possible

I'm going to start on Wrex at some point soon too, I love how you've drawn up a full scale plan of the costume. Are you building from a pattern or from scratch?
 
thanks! i drew wrex as a vector drawing based on some great reference material on deviant art. a high school teacher friend of mine printed it out life sized. i've been building directly from this. i make poster board/card board patterns as i go. i have my ipad handy at all times- several good reference images there. everything is in line with the drawing.the head i did sculpt a little too big.. i would have done things very differently now. this is my first eva build. some growing pains indeed

Is the head cast out of latex? :)
 
latex from the forehead shell line down. the top is a white semirigid resin backed with urethane foam. really light for it's size. i also cast a "skull" out of softer foam to fill out the face so it isn't so floppy. most of the $$$ was tied up in the head fabrication. it was a big urethane rubber mold. my blog link up top has a video of me pulling it out of the mold. i think the video is still up
